ABU DHABI // A woman seeking Dh1 million compensation over breast enlargement surgery she claimed was botched has had her claim rejected by the Appeals Court.

The court overturned a ruling by a lower court entitling the woman to Dh10,000, deciding that even if the clinic had been negligent in some respects, no physical damage had been done.

The lower court found that the substance the woman was injected with was not registered by the Ministry of Health and that a ban prevented it from being used on women with a family history of cancer. The woman, who had such a family history, claimed she had been left emotionally and psychologically damaged from the operation, saying she suffered constant panic about catching cancer.
